Professional 4K capture in a compact, plug-and-play device — the Magewell USB Capture HDMI 4K Pro 32150 delivers broadcast-grade HDMI ingest over USB 3.2 with support for 4K60 video, HDR10, and deep-color formats. TYrue 4K60 HDMI 2.0 Input: Capture high-resolution video up to 4096×2160 at 60fps with full HDMI 2.0 bandwidth. Perfect for UHD cameras, gaming consoles, medical imaging systems, presentation devices and more. HDR & Deep-Color Fidelity: Supports HDR10 and 10-bit/12-bit video formats for exceptional color accuracy. Ideal for workflows requiring dynamic range preservation and precise color reproduction. FPGA Hardware Processing: Built-in video processing includes scaling, cropping, de-interlacing, aspect-ratio conversion, color-space conversion and OSD — all handled on-device to reduce load on your host PC. Simple USB 3.2 Connectivity: Driver-free operation on Windows, macOS and Linux ensures immediate compatibility. Just connect HDMI in and USB 3.0 out and you’re ready to capture. Optimized for Professional Production: With low latency, stable long-term operation and broad software support, the USB Capture HDMI 4K Pro fits perfectly into broadcast, AV, gaming, streaming and post-production environments. Supports HDMI 2.0 input and capture up to 4096×2160 at 60fps for crystal-clear UHD recording, streaming, conferencing, or monitoring.
Handles 10-bit and 12-bit input formats with HDR10 passthrough for professional-quality dynamic range and color accuracy. Software requires support through Magewell SDK. Not available through standard UVC.
Hardware-based de-interlacing, up/downscaling, cropping, color conversion and OSD reduce CPU usage and ensure stable performance.
Built-in HDMI loop-through port lets you preview your source in real time without additional splitters or delay.
Capture embedded HDMI audio or use external mic/line input; headphone output enables real-time monitoring.
